    Here is a list of our sightings in Borneo (mostly at Uncle Tan’s, few at Mulu and Mt Kinabalu) .Thanks to Adarsh for sharing his list with me.

    Mammals

    Dusky fruit bat

    Proboscis monkey

    1. Orangutan
    2. Proboscis Monkey
    3. Bornean Gibbon
    4. Long-tailed macaque
    5. Dusky Fruit Bat
    6. Prevost’s squirrel
    7. Giant Squirrel
    8. Plantain squirrel
    9. Plain pigmy squirrel
    10. Civet Cat

    Birds

    Little Spider hunter

    Birds of Borneo: Shrike (Brown?)

    Birds of Borneo: Shrike (Black winged?)

    Black hooded Kingfisher

    1. Argus, Great
    2. Babbler, White Chested
    3. Babbler, Chestnut winged
    4. Bee Eater, Blue Throated
    5. Broadbill, Black and Red
    6. Broadbill, Black and Yellow
    7. Coucal, Larger (heard)
    8. Darter, Oriental
    9. Dollar Bird
    10. Dove, Emerald
    11. Dove, Spotted
    12. Eagle, Grey Headed Fish
    13. Eagle, White Bellied Sea
    14. Egret, Great
    15. Fantail, Pied
    16. Flycatcher, Malaysian Blue
    17. Flycathcer, Blue and white
    18. Heron, Black Crowned
    19. Heron, Purple
    20. Hornbill, Black
    21. Hornbill, Pied
    22. Hornbill, Rhinoceros
    23. Hornbill, Wrinkled
    24. Kingfisher, Black Backed
    25. Kingfisher, Blue Eared
    26. Kingfisher, Stork Billed
    27. Kingfisher, White Collared
    28. Kite, Brahminy
    29. Munia, Black Headed
    30. Owl, Buffy Fish
    31. Parakeets, Long tailed
    32. Plover, Common Ringed
    33. Sparrow
    34. Spiderhunter, Little
    35. Sunbird, Crimson
    36. Swallow, Pacific
    37. Trogon, Scarlet Rumped
    38. Woodpecker, ?
    39. At least 5 unidentified species of birds

    Reptiles


    A friend in the wild waters of Kinabatangan

    Lizard at Gunung Mulu

    ID pls (Green tree frog?)

    1. Salt Water Crocodile
    2. Monitor Lizard
    3. Bronzed Back Snake
    4. Flying Lizard
    5. Few unidentified species of frogs
    6. Crested Lizard

    ——————————————————————————————————————————————

    Others


    Nepenthes - Pitcher plant

    ID pls

    1. Pitcher Plants (Nepenthes)
    2. Cocoa plant
    3. Spider n wasp
    4. Stick Insects
    5. Cotton Bugs
    6. Lantern bug
    7. Componatus Gigas – Largest Ant
    8. Spider wasp paralyze a spider
    9. Stick Insects Mating
    10. Damsel fly
    11. Numerous buterflies
